Market Wala perfect dhoklas at home without Eno and suji

Ingredients
- Besan-1 cup 150 g
- Salt-1tsp
- Yogurt-2 tbsps
- Water-1glass
- Fresh lemon juice-2 tbsps
- Baking Powder-1tsp
- Baking Soda-1/4 tsp
- Chillies-4 pcs
- fresh curry patta
- Black mustard seeds-1tsp
- Oil - 1 tbsp

Instructions
- Mix gradually besan, water,salt,fresh lemon juice(1tbsp) and yogurt(2 tbsps) in a bowl slowly without forming lumps .
- Keep in aside for 30 mins.
- Boil water in your steamer(I used momo steamer )
- After 30 mins add baking powder and baking soda to the dhokla mixture and mixed it properly .
- Grease the tin where you will make the dhokla (i used 3x7 inch cake tin) and set it in the steamer . note:After mixting the baking soda and powder set the tin immediately in the steamer.
- It will take around 20 to 25 mins (poke with a teeth pick to check whether cooked properly) .
- Once cooked, keep it aside to cool down.
- Boil 1 cup of water with 2 tbsp sugar and 1 tbsp fresh lemon juice.
- Take the dhokla out of the tin and pour the sugar syrup over the dhokla and let it absorb properly
- Heat 1 tbsp oil in a pan and splutter some black mustard seeds, curry patta and chillies for garnish.
Notes
After mixting the baking soda and powder set the tin immediately in the steamer.
poke with a teeth pick to check whether cooked properly .
Demold only after it cools down.
